Java ME

Cargador de aplicaciones - iDEN Java Application Loader 2007

Esta versión incluye soporte para sistemas Windows Vista y para los equipos Nextel lanzados en el año 2007.


SDK de Motorola iDEN

Los SDKs (siglas en inglés para Software Development Kit, kit de herramientas de desarrollo) de Motorola corresponden a los equipos iDEN disponibles en el mercado. Cada SDK contiene un emulador del equipo correspondiente, las utilidades y clases necesarias para compilar un programa Java, y otras herramientas de desarrollo (firmas digitales, GPS, cobertura, interacción de mensajería de texto y Java, manejo de interconexióń, etc.).


Guia de desarrollo Motorola iDEN J2ME 2007 (en inglés)

Guía completa que describe toda la funcionalidad en Java de los equipos iDEN, incluyendo ejemplos de código fuente, observaciones, y prácticas de desarrollo.


APIs Java ME recientemente desaprobados en el Motorola i876

El nuevo equipo Motorola i876 incluye varios cambios al entorno Java ME. Eso incluye algunas APIs que fueron desaprobadas y ya no serán incluidas por ser redundantes o porque existen APIs estándares Java (conocidos como JSRs) con más funcionalidad.

Las APIs eliminadas en el i876 son las siguientes:


Java Mobile & Embedded Developer Days - Presentaciones

Las presentaciones de la primera conferencia dedicada exclusivamente al desarrollo Java ME pueden ser descargadas de la página del "Mobile and Embedded Developer Days"


Java Mobile and Embedded Developer Days - Webcast Mundial

El Java Mobile & Embedded Developer Days será un encuentro mundial de desarrolladores Java ME -- pero sabemos que muchos de ustedes no van a poder viajar hasta California. Por lo tanto, la conferência completa va a ser transmitida, sin costo, a través de Ustream.TV.


iDEN SDK para Motorola i876

El nuevo SDK para el Motorola i876 incluye las herramientas necesarias para compilar y emular aplicaciones Java ME desarrollados para equipos Motorola i876.


Cómo usar NetBeans y DeviceAnywhere para desarrollar en equipos reales

El servicio de control remoto por Internet de equipos reales DeviceAnywhere permite fácilmente probar una aplicación J2ME en un equipo real.

¿Qué ventajas tiene probar en un equipo DeviceAnywhere?

  • Puede probar su aplicación en una variedad de equipos iDEN reales pagando sólo por el tiempo que use el equipo.
  • Tiene la habilidad de grabar video y audio generado por el equipo, lo que puede servir para instructivos o demostraciones

Administración de Aplicaciones Java

Si tuviese la necesidad de hacer que una aplicación Java ME en un equipo Nextel siempre esté activa, no pueda ser borrada o que los permisos que tiene la aplicación no puedan ser cambiadas sin autorización, los nuevos equipos Motorola tienen una serie de funciones que le serán útiles.

Para usarlas, es necesario ingresar al menu Java en el equipo (Aplicaciones Java), e ingresar la secuencia siguiente:

#159#

El equipo pedirá una contraseña: la seña inicial es 0000. Después de establecer una nueva contraseña, el siguiente menú de opciones estará disponible:


Ejemplo de MIDlet ejecutando acciones mientras pausado

El código que sigue es de un MIDlet que se pausa automáticamente al ser iniciado y que mantiene un proceso activo mientras la aplicación está pausada. Esto permite ver dos cosas:

  1. cómo hacer que una aplicación se pause por sí sola
  2. cómo hacer que una aplicación que esté en pausa continúe ejecutando alguna operación deseada